In was the closing night of Bluesfest 2011,Find the latest styles and dsquaredshoes. and most everyone in front, behind and on the stage knew the violent storm was coming.

They had known for almost an hour, but it was unthinkable that this monolithic main stage, 45 metres wide and 17 metres high, wouldn’t be able to withstand one of those typical Ottawa summer windstorms.

At Ottawa airport, the wind speed was recorded at 96 kilometres an hour. How fast the wind was travelling when it arrived at the festival site remains unclear. Some think 120 km/h, others even higher.

There were about 20 people on the stage as it began to collapse. Most prominent among them was the veteran Illinois rock band Cheap Trick, whose members had been enthusiastically running through their greatest hits catalogue when in a sudden, horrifying realization of impending disaster, lead singer Robin Zander screamed, “Get off the stage. Zander wasn’t the first to see, or to sense, the gravity of the situation. He might even have been among the last. He got the message to evacuate from sound engineer Mike Cormack, 31, who had been told to cut the main sound feed.

Seconds before the collapse, and with chunks of metal already dropping from the tonnage of rigging 22 metres above, members of the stage crew were already desperately trying to minimize whatever damage and injury was about to descend.

If heroes emerged in the chaotic minutes before and after the collapse, members of Ottawa’s tightly knit stage crew community were certainly among them.

“You learned a lot about people that night,” says Sacha Morazain, a former partner in Project X Productions, which employed many of the crew. “They stepped up and risked their lives.”

When they saw what was about to happen, Freddy Steele, 43, and Jay McNicol, 35, riggers and spotlight operators, ran from the “front of house,” the tall tower-like structure looming over the rear of the crowd that holds the sound board and other technical equipment.

But even as they were dashing toward the stage, Cormack and others were already on it pushing people off — the 25 or so highest bidders for the Best Seats in the House and a few assorted dignitaries who had turned up for an end-of-festival presentation before Cheap Trick’s set.

A guy with a tray of beer pushed his way up the stage stairs as others were scrambling down. He got difficult and in one swoop, a member of the stage crew knocked the beers out of his hand and pushed him down the stairs. It would be half an hour or so later that the guy, contrite and tearful, sought out the man who’d robbed him of his beer: “Thanks for saving my life, man,” he said.

The stage crew say the back canvas wall of the stage should have come apart under pressure from the wind, but it hadn’t.
